Description:
Perennial herb, growing from corms. Stems repeatedly branched. Inflorescence branched, the flowers crowded terminally. Flowers often purple-blue with dark blue and pale nectar guides on the three lower tepals. There are,however, several other colour forms: a deep maroon-red form, usually lacking markings, which appears to be more widespread at lower altitudes, and a blue form which is more common elsewhere. Flowers may rarely be pale mauve or white, with or without dark markings on the lower tepals.
Notes:
Derivation of specific name: erythranthus: red-flowered, despite the fact that flowers are often blue-violet
Habitat: Fairly widespread, occurring on shallow soil over granite rock or on badly drained soil in woodland and grassland.
Altitude range:
Flowering time:Dec - Mar
Worldwide distribution: Angola, Botswana, DRC (Shaba), Tanzania, Malawi, Mozambique, Zambia and Zimbabwe
